From: Mutations in human AID differentially affect its ability to deaminate cytidine and 5-methylcytidine in ssDNA substrates in vitro

Figure 2

Analyses of enzyme’s concentration-dependent deamination of C (a) and 5 mC (b) containing substrates by wt hAID and N51A mutant. The graph presents the dependence between the yield of C/5 mC deamination reactions and enzyme concentration (wt hAID (triangles) and N51A mutant (circles)). UDG-coupled and TDG-coupled deamination assays (see Methods) were used for C and 5 mC substrates, respectively. Error bars represent standard deviation from the mean of at least three independent replicates. Representative PAGE analyses of the products of deamination reaction are shown on the right. Positive and negative control reactions are indicated by “+” or “−”, respectively. The cropped gel images are displayed. Full-length gel images are shown in Supplementary Fig. S7.
